The welcome plant, also known as the Dieffenbachia plant, is considered toxic to humans and pets if ingested. The sap of the plant can cause irritation and swelling of the mouth and throat. There is no evidence to suggest that it is cancerous.

A poisonous plant is most poisonous when it is ingested or comes into direct contact with the body. The toxicity level depends on various factors such as the plant species, the part of the plant consumed, the amount consumed, and the sensitivity of the individual. The concentration of toxins can also vary depending on factors like plant maturity and environmental conditions.

The scientific name for the plant commonly known as Naked ladies is Amaryllis belladonna. It belongs to the Amaryllidaceae family and is a perennial bulbous plant native to South Africa. The plant is also known as belladonna lily or Jersey lily.
